Ajaokuta steel workers deny leadership crisis

Published by

WORKERS of the Ajaokuta Steel Company, Kogi state on Friday debunked insinuation of leadership crisis in the organisation, warning against attempt to orchestrate another tussle.

The workers under the aegis of the Iron and Steel Senior Staff Association of Nigeria (ISSSAN) and Steel and Engineering Workers Union of Nigeria (SEWUN), also dissociated themselves from a petition purportedly raising the alarm over leadership crisis in the company.

A legal practitioner, Salifu Usman, in the petition, said that the workers had accused the Sole Administrator of the company, Engr Joseph Isah,  of contravening several financial and administrative regulations of government including illegally diverting workers promotion allowances as well as selling the company’s landed properties to clients.

But the unions in a statement jointly signed by the Chairmen and Secretaries of the two unions, Comrade Nuhu O Salawu, Comrade Usman Bashir, Comrade Attah James and Comrade Ade Atabo Omebo respectively, said they never “consulted, talked to, briefed or solicited the assistance of anybody let alone the said Mr Salifu Oguche Usman to write any petition on our behalf on matters of succession in the Company or any other matter therein.”

According to the unions, the process of appointing or removing the Chief Executive Officer of the company and parastatals of the federal government was largely political and at the discretion of Government.

“At no point did workers appoint chief executives for the organization. In the case of Engineer Isah, it is true he was employed in 1982 and appointed Sole Administrator in 2012. Though we are not lawyers, we however know as of fact that there is a difference between “employment’’ and ‘’appointment”.

“We also know as of fact that when Engr Isah was appointed Sole Administrator of Ajaokuta Steel Plant, Engr A.Y Ibrahim was also appointed Sole Administrator of the National Iron Ore Mining Company, (NIOMCO) Itakpe in November 2012.

“It might interest Mr Salifu Oguche Usman to know that as at the time of the appointment of Engr. A.Y Ibrahim to Head NIOMCO, Itakpe, he Engr. Ibrahim had already retired from Public Service and his appointment stood till he voluntarily withdrew his services and the current Chief Executive Officer was appointed to take over.

“It is also a fact the current NIOMCO Chief Executive Officer had also retired before his current appointment.”

The unions also noted that the issue the issue of 2012 promotion arrears had been addressed by the management as all the relevant documentations have been sent to the Federal Government.

“We in the union have made several follow ups to the Office of the Accountant General of the Federation and we are confident that all staff who are qualified will be paid when the Federal Government does so, as assured during the 2017 Civil Service Week by the Head of Civil Service of the Federation.

“It should also be noted that all Salaries and allowances of our Members are being paid directly to their accounts through the Integrated Payroll System of the Federal Government (IPPIS) and no funds associated with Salaries of Workers come to Ajaokuta,” the unions said.
